Rules of Transport – Fanøtrafikken A/S
For transport by Fanøtrafikken, the following conditions for responsibility, liability and limitation of liability shall apply to passengers, vehicles and luggage conveyed by our ferries or by a ferry chartered by us.
In all other respects, Fanøtrafikken has limited liability in damages for faults, as well as for personal injury and property damage in accordance with the rules of the Danish Merchant Shipping Act of 1994.
Tickets
Booking is not available for the ferry line Esbjerg-Fanø.
Tickets and cards for vehicles are available for purchase at the automatic check-in automats, and passenger tickets are available for purchase at the terminal in Esbjerg. Tickets are valid for the next vacant departure. The passenger must keep the ticket for the entire trip. The passenger must present the ticket on demand.
If a customer has mislaid or lost his ticket, a new ticket must be purchased.
Refunds
Tickets are refunded by cancellations.
Outdated/lost tickets are not refunded. No ticket may be refunded more that 12 months after last date of validity.
Generally, Fanøtrafikken’s 10 Trip Cards, 30 Trips Cards, Monthly Cards and Annual Cards are valid for 12 months after purchase date. If other conditions apply, this will be stated on the cards.
By the refund of cards that are partly used, the customer pays the ordinary fare per realized trip at the actual time. An expedition fee of DKK 75 will be charged and the rest amount will be paid out to the customer.
Monthly Cards and Annual Cards are not refunded.
A customer requesting a refund must send the original ticket(s) and card(s) to Fanøtrafikken A/S, c/o Nordic Ferry Services, Dampskibskajen 3, DK-3700 Rønne, att.: Agentsupport, stating a bank account number to which the amount of refund can be transferred.

Safety Conditions
Due to the risk of fire, smoking and the use of open fire on the car deck or in the vehicles onboard is forbidden.
Before leaving the vehicle, the driver must set the handbrake and put the vehicle into 1st gear.
The passenger areas are surveyed by video. Any kind of theft will be handed over to the police.
Transport of sick /disabled persons
Fanøtrafikken can require that sick / disabled persons bring a personal helper during the trip.
Fanøtrafikken cannot nurse sick / disabled persons onboard.
Fanøtrafikken does not offer any kind of assistance to sick /disabled persons in connection with their boarding or leaving the ferry.

Freight
All vehicles with a total weight of over 3,500 kg are designated as lorries.
Any vehicle must be equipped with lashing fittings for attachment to the ship. The goods must be adequately lashed and secured to resist any action caused by transport at sea.
The carrier/driver is personally responsible for ensuring that the load is justifiably lashed and secured on his vehicle.
The decision of the Chief Officer is final with regard to securing loads/lashings, or if a load is refused, if necessary
For the conveyance of live animals, the driver must inform Fanøtrafikken of this not later than at the time of boarding the ferry.
Dangerous goods are to be conveyed in accordance with the regulations of the IMDG code. Fanøtrafikken must be notified in writing of the dangerous goods to be conveyed not less than 24 hours before the transport is to occur. Liquid may not drip from any vehicle. Fanøtrafikken assumes no liability for any damage that occurs to vehicles and freight while parked in waiting/harbour areas.
With regard to the conveyance of lorries, as well as freight transported by these, Fanøtrafikken limits its liability pursuant to Section 13 of the Danish Merchant Shipping Act.

Service delays and cancellations
If a passenger chooses to discontinue a trip because of a prolonged delay, or because a travel connection could not be made, the passenger is entitled to a refund of the ticket for the part of the trip which could not be carried out as a result of the delay.
Fanøtrafikken assumes no liability for any lack of space on the vessels or for operational disruptions, including service stoppage. In such cases, Fanøtrafikken will try to reduce the inconvenience to the passengers.
Fanøtrafikken assumes no liability for damage or losses that occur due to irregularities of service including Force Majeure, technical causes, water and weather conditions. Fanøtrafikken reserves the right to change time tables and prices without any notice. At any time, another vessel than the vessel having been published to carry out the trip can be put into service. Fanøtrafikken is never responsible for losses that occur in connection with lost travel connection or necessary changes of itinerary, including extra hotel stay or similar that a passenger chooses as a result of a delay.
